Overview
An Evening With David Sedaris brings the renowned author and humorist to the historic St James Theatre Wellington, where audiences will gather to experience his unique storytelling. David Sedaris is currently active on his 2026–2027 tour, visiting over 20 cities across North America and New Zealand, following a successful run that began in March 2026 in Burlington, VT. His tour showcases his signature blend of memoir, comedy, and cultural observation, making this event a standout for fans of literary theater.
David Sedaris is celebrated for his deeply personal and witty narratives, often drawing from his family life and travels, which have captivated readers and theatergoers worldwide. His performances are known for intimate engagement and sharp, heartfelt humor that resonates with diverse audiences. The St James Theatre Wellington, a cornerstone of New Zealand’s cultural scene, offers an elegant and acoustically rich setting that enhances the storytelling experience of this acclaimed evening.
